Strategic Partnerships Announced
UiPath (NYSE: PATH), a leader in agentic automation, has recently announced a series of strategic partnerships with major technology companies including Snowflake, OpenAI, Nvidia, and Google. These collaborations aim to integrate advanced artificial intelligence (AI) capabilities into UiPath's automation platform, enhancing its ability to automate complex business processes based on real-time data insights.
The partnership with Snowflake focuses on merging UiPath’s Agentic Automation platform with Snowflake's Cortex AI. This integration allows enterprises to automate actions derived from both structured and unstructured data, enabling organizations to act swiftly on insights without overhauling existing systems. Snowflake's Cortex Agents will facilitate the retrieval of information, which UiPath agents can then use to execute workflows.
Enhancements to Automation Capabilities
In addition to the Snowflake collaboration, UiPath has partnered with Nvidia to incorporate generative AI into its automation solutions. This partnership will enhance workflows in sensitive areas such as fraud detection and healthcare by utilizing Nvidia's advanced AI models. The integration includes an Integration Service Connector that allows seamless incorporation of AI features into UiPath's applications.
Furthermore, the collaboration with OpenAI introduces a ChatGPT connector, enabling enterprises to leverage natural language processing and document summarization within their workflows. This integration is expected to simplify the development of AI agents and streamline automation processes.
Google's partnership brings voice-enabled automation capabilities to the UiPath platform, allowing users to manage automation through natural language commands. This feature aims to enhance user experience and accessibility in automation tasks.
Market Reaction and Implications
The announcement of these partnerships has positively impacted UiPath's stock performance, with shares rising significantly in pre-market trading. Following the news, UiPath's stock surged by approximately 23% before stabilizing at a 15% gain during the opening session. This market reaction reflects investor confidence in UiPath's strategy to position itself as a key player in the enterprise AI ecosystem.
Official Statements
Graham Sheldon, Chief Product Officer at UiPath, emphasized the importance of these partnerships, stating, “By combining Snowflake Cortex AI with the UiPath Platform, customers can turn trusted insights into orchestrated action without reworking their existing systems.” Baris Gultekin, Vice President of AI at Snowflake, added, “Together, we’re empowering organizations to not only understand their data in real time, but also to execute on it with precision.”
